Anda di halaman 1dari 18

Username (armila)

Pasword (ArmilaJayantiFisikaB)

1. Buka aplikasi Borland delphi 7


2. Selanjutnya pada form pertama, buat form pesembahan, form ini bisa di desin sesuka
kita. Isinya berupa kata sambutan dan media player untuk menambahkan musik jika
ingin.

3. Tambahkan sebuah media player agar bisa menggunakan musik


4. Selanjutnya tambhkan opendialog dan main menu. Didalam main menu di masukkan
rumus sbb:
5. Sebelumnya. Musik yang kita inginkan simpan terlebih dahulu didalam file proyek
yang kita miliki.
6. Tambhkan satu buah button, beri nama ‘masuk’. Button ini berfungsi untuk pergi ke
form 2 yakni form login. Masukkan rumus seperti gambar dibawah
7. Selanjutnya pada form login, tambhkan 2 buah label dan 2 buah edit serta 2 buah
button. Untuk nama dan pasword:

8. Rumusnya sptri gmbar di bawah


if (edit1.text<>'armila') or (edit2.text<>'ArmilaJayantiFisikaB')then
begin
messageDlg ('coba lagi!!',MTWarning,[MBOK],0);
exit;
end;
form3.show;
form2.hide;
end;

end.
9. Pada button ‘login’ masukkan rumus supaya bisa masuk ke menu utama. Yakni
dengan cara klik 2 klai pd button. Ketik Form3.show; Form2.Hide;
10. Pada form menu utama masukkan beberapa button dengan nama sperti gambar
dibawah:
11. Pada button KD merupakan button yang akan menghubungkan kita ke form yang
berisi kompetensi dasar dari materi. Rumusnya form4.show;
12. Pada button indikator, berisi from indikator yang akan di capai. Rumusnya
Form5.show; (atau bisa diganti formindikator.show;)
13. Pada button materi berisi ppt materi pelajaran. Mesukkan ppt menggunakan OLE.
Berikut cara nya:
a. Tambhkan ole pada system
b. Pastikan ppt yang ingin kita masukkan sudah disave didalam folder yang sama
dan di save dalam bentuk pps
c. Selanjutnya klik 2 kali pada ole akan muncul seperti gambar dibawah:
d. Plih create file, lalu klik file yang sudah di simpan tadi dan tekan oke
14. Button Visualisasi animasi merupakan button yang digunakan untuk masuk ke form
yang berisi animasi. Car membuat animasi:
a. Masukkan
b. 1. Klik menu Additional pilih Image

c. Pada Object Inspector pilih Picture kemudian klik Load,pilih foto yang ingin
dijadikan animasi
d. Klik menu Sistem dan pilih Timer

e. Pilih menu Button 2 kali dengan caption Play dan Replay


f. Untuk Timer,lakukan format seperti berikut :
var
Form1: TForm1;
nomorgambar:integer;
implementation
{$R *.dfm}
procedure TForm1.Timer1Timer(Sender: TObject);
begin

case nomorgambar of

0: image1.Picture.LoadFromFile('1.jpg');
1: image1.Picture.LoadFromFile('2.jpg');
2: image1.Picture.LoadFromFile('3.jpg');
3: image1.Picture.LoadFromFile('4.jpg');

end;

inc(nomorgambar);

if nomorgambar = 4 then nomorgambar:=0;

end;

Untuk tombol Button1 lakukan format seperti berikut :

procedure TForm1.Button1Click(Sender: TObject);


g. begin

timer1.Enabled:=true;

end;

Untuk tombol Button2 lakukan format sebagai berikut :

procedure TForm1.Button2Click(Sender: TObject);

begin

\timer1.Enabled:=false;
nomorgambar:=0;

image1.Picture.LoadFromFile('1.jpg');

end;
end.

15. Button latihan merupakan button yang akan menghubungkan kita ke form yang bersi
soal latihan. Latihan dimasukkan menggunakan ole: selanjutnya ada pembahasan
yang di beri pengaman pasword

Rumus pada pembahasan soal:


16. Button evaluasi
Langkah pertama:
1. Masukkan picture sebagai gambar untuk background. Selanjutnya potong
semua soal menjadi satu soal satu gambar.

2. Masukkan 10 buah button yang namanya No1 sampai dengan No10. Lalu
tambahkan combobox untuk membuka soal.
Selanjutnya pada button nomor masukkan rumus
Untuk No1:
image1.picture.LoadFromFile ('1G.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button2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('2g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button3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('3g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button4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('4g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button5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('5g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button6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('6g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button7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('7g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button8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('8g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button9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('9g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;

procedure TForm9.Button10Click(Sender: TObject);


begin
image1.picture.LoadFromFile ('10g.bmp');
inc (NomorGambar);
if NomorGambar = 1 then NomorGambar:=0;
end;
dalam combobox masukkan pilihan A sampai E.

3. Selanjutnya tambahkan 10 buah edit 4 buah botton dan satu buah edit lagi

Pada button hitung masukkan rumus sebagai berikut:


procedure TForm9.Button11Click(Sender: TObject);
begin
If ComboBox1.text = 'D' then
edit1.Text:= '10';
if ComboBox1.text <> 'D' then
edit1.Text:= '0';
If ComboBox2.text = 'B' then
edit2.Text:= '10';
if ComboBox2.text <> 'B' then
edit2.Text:= '0';
If ComboBox3.text = 'C' then
edit3.Text:= '10';
if ComboBox3.text <> 'C' then
edit3.Text:= '0';
If ComboBox4.text = 'E' then
edit4.Text:= '10';
if ComboBox4.text <> 'E' then
edit4.Text:= '0';
If ComboBox5.text = 'C' then
edit5.Text:= '10';
if ComboBox5.text <> 'C' then
edit5.Text:= '0';
If ComboBox6.text = 'B' then
edit6.Text:= '10';
if ComboBox6.text <> 'B' then
edit6.Text:= '0';
If ComboBox7.text = 'C' then
edit7.Text:= '10';
if ComboBox7.text <> 'C' then
edit7.Text:= '0';
If ComboBox8.text = 'E' then
edit8.Text:= '10';
if ComboBox8.text <> 'E' then
edit8.Text:= '0';
If ComboBox9.text = 'D' then
edit9.Text:= '10';
if ComboBox9.text <> 'D' then
edit9.Text:= '0';
If ComboBox10.text = 'D' then
edit10.Text:= '10';
if ComboBox10.text <> 'D' then
edit10.Text:= '0';

end;

4. Pada button nilai akhir masukkan rumus sbb:


Na:=(Strtofloat(edit1.Text)+Strtofloat(edit2.Text)+Strtofloat(Edit3.Text)+Strtoflo
at(Edit4.Text)+Strtofloat(Edit5.Text)+Strtofloat(Edit6.Text)+Strtofloat(Edit7.Text
)+Strtofloat(Edit8.Text)+Strtofloat(Edit9.Text)+Strtofloat(Edit10.Text));
edit11.text:=FloattoStr(Na);
end;
Maka akan muncul hasil akhir pada edit 11.
5. Selajutnya pda button hasil akhir masukkan
Rumus masukkan rumus form14.show;
6. Dalam form 14 tambahkan 1 buah Label, 1 buah

7. Namai button satu dengan PROSES. Didalam button tersebut dimasukkan rumus
sebagai berikut:
procedure TForm14.Button1Click(Sender: TObject);
begin
Na:= Strtofloat (Form9.edit11.text);

If Na = 100 then
form14.Label1.Caption:= 'You are excellent !!!'
else if Na = 90 then
form14.Label1.Caption:= 'You are best !!'
else if Na = 80 then
form14.Label1.Caption:= 'You are very good!'
else if Na = 70 then
form14.Label1.Caption:= 'You are nice '
else if Na = 60 then
form14.Label1.Caption:= 'You are good but not enough'
else if Na = 50 then
form14.Label1.Caption:= 'Study hard please'
else if Na = 40 then
form14.Label1.Caption:= 'Study hard please'
else if Na = 30 then
form14.Label1.Caption:= 'Study hard please'
else if Na = 20 then
form14.Label1.Caption:= 'Gagal !!!!!!!!!'
else if Na = 10 then
form14.Label1.Caption:= 'Gagal !!!!!!!!!'
else if Na = 0 then
form14.Label1.Caption:= 'Gagal !!!!!!!!!'
end;

end.
17. Selesai

Anda mungkin juga menyukai